Where to Get a Piano or Keyboard in Canton

For Canton families, the best first instrument is usually the one that lets the student practice comfortably and often. Students who are just beginning often do well with a quality digital piano, while a maintained upright can support stronger touch as repertoire grows. A beginner setup should include 88 weighted keys when possible, a real sustain pedal, stable seating, and a place where practice can stay set up. New and used options may appear through The Music Farm and Canal Fulton Music, Facebook Marketplace, Craigslist, OfferUp, or neighborhood resale groups. For online piano lessons in Canton, you need a piano or weighted-key keyboard, reliable internet, and a device with a camera so the teacher can see your hands and posture. Beginners can often start with a digital piano or weighted keyboard. A quiet lesson space helps the student focus.

For Canton families, an upright acoustic piano can give richer tone and touch, but it also needs space, maintenance, and tuning. Either option can work when the setup includes weighted keys, a pedal, reasonable bench height, and dependable sound. Families should weigh volume control, space, budget, maintenance, and how often the student will practice.

Many children in Canton start piano lessons around ages 5 to 7, but readiness matters more than the number. Look for attention span, growing finger independence, interest in music, and the ability to follow simple directions. Older beginners can also start successfully with the right pace.
